BirdDog

"tomato, potato"

submission: BirdDog
date: October 7, 2008

Neat stuff, really neat. I liked yr style a lot, and I see where yr influence from Firth comes from. that being said, be careful you aren't just emulating him. Some of the architecture for instance was straight up Toast boy, and there was the undeniable Salad Fingers vibe. However, it's also undeniable that you put a lot of work and care into this, and originality issues aside, you've got a really nice piece here. Keep it up, i'm sure you'll find yr 'thing' soon enough.
